Job Description

Small Door is membership-based veterinary care designed with human standards that is better for pets pet parents and veterinarians alike. We designed and delivered a reimagined veterinary experience via a membership that includes exceptional care 24/7 telemedicine and transparent pricing - delivered with modern hospitality in spaces designed by animal experts to be stress-free. We opened our flagship location in Manhattans West Village in 2020 and have quickly expanded across the East Coast. Small Door now operates in New York City Boston Washington DC and Maryland with continued expansion plans in 2025.

At Small Door our nurses are part of a supportive and collaborative network invested in their growth. Our nurses have the opportunity to work in state-of-the-art facilities with strong doctor:nurse staffing ratios and have the added support of a 24/7 telehealth team and dedicated call center that drastically reduces incoming calls to the practice - this means you can focus on the pets in front of you! We are committed to a healthy work/life balance and are dedicated to creating and maintaining a positive work addition to practicing Fear Free and being AAHA accredited were also the only Certified B-Corp General Practice Veterinary Company in the country meaning we abide by incredibly high standards as an organization.

*You MUST be a Licensed Veterinary Technician in the state of New York to apply to this job*

What youll do

  • Triaging
  • Knowledge and ability to recognize medical emergencies and illnesses
  • Assessing patients
  • Recording vitals and assisting doctors with diagnostics
  • Completing treatments as instructed by the doctor
  • Basic husbandry and nursing care
  • Monitoring changes in patients and providing compassionate care
  • Taking blood
  • Placing catheters
  • Assisting in and facilitating radiography capture
  • Preparing samples for outside reference labs
  • Running in-house labs
  • Preparing medications
  • Administering medications
  • Additional responsibilities to maintain a hospitable environment

Who you are

  • 1 years of experience as a LVT
  • Availability to work every other Saturday with a rotating schedule
    Week 1 (4 x 10 hour shifts)
    Week 2 (3 x 10 hour shifts (1) 8 hour Sat Shift
  • Comfortable with computers and online tools
  • Strong enough to lift 50 lbs
  • A thoughtful and fearless team player
  • A go-getter who thrives in a fast-paced environment
  • Skilled at communicating with clients
  • Passionate about pets
